Transfer Options from Millennium Airport Hotel Dubai to DXB

Public Transport: Metro & Bus

  • Dubai Metro: The Red Line connects GGICO Station (near the hotel) to Terminal 1 and 3 in 5 minutes. Fares start at AED 4 ($1.10). Trains run every 4–8 minutes.
  • Bus: Route C01 links the hotel to DXB terminals, taking 15–20 minutes. Use a Nol Card (AED 25, including credit) for payment.

While affordable, public transport may be less ideal for those with heavy luggage or tight schedules.

Taxi & Rideshare

  • Dubai Taxi: Metered fares cost AED 15–25 ($4–7) for the 5–10 minute ride. Book via the Dubai Taxi app or hail one curbside.
  • Careem/Uber: Prices range AED 20–35 ($5–10). Confirm pickup points with your driver.

Taxis are reliable, but traffic during rush hours (7–9 AM, 5–7 PM) can delay journeys.

Car Rentals

Major providers like Hertz and Europcar operate at DXB. Rates start at AED 150/day ($41), but consider:

  • Parking fees at the hotel (AED 15–30/hour).
  • Toll gates (Salik) on major highways (AED 4 per pass).

Travel Tips & Local Insights

  1. Book transfers early during peak seasons (November–March).
  2. Avoid rush hours if possible—Dubai’s roads congest quickly.
  3. Tip drivers 5–10% for exceptional service (optional but appreciated).
  4. Download apps: S’hail for public transport and Careem for rideshares.
